Oligospermy in China: how does this condition affect male fertility?

When talking about male infertility, the most common causes are usually taken into account. However, some alterations are often associated with other diseases and underlying conditions that can lead to the development of further complications, which, if detected early, are feasible to correct or lead to more effective alternative solutions.

Oligospermy is a common and significant condition that can hinder male fertility by reducing the quantity of sperm in the semen. According to data provided by the World Health Organization (WHO), a man is diagnosed with oligospermy when his sperm concentration is below 15 million spermatozoa per milliliter.

Oligospermy can be caused by various diseases, such as hormonal disorders, testicular problems or infections. In many cases, Oligospermy is associated with other conditions, such as those described below:

Cryptorchidism: a condition associated with oligospermy

Cryptorchidism refers to the condition wherein one or both testicles fail to descend into the scrotum before birth. This can give rise to fertility difficulties because the undescended testicles are exposed to elevated temperatures, which can impact the production of sperm.

Cryptorchidism is most common in a single testicle (80%) and the left testicle is the most affected. Bilateral cryptorchidism is less common. To prevent fertility difficulties, boys with cryptorchidism need to have surgery to descend the testicles before the age of 2 years.

Varicocele

Testicular varicocele is a condition that causes dilation of the veins supplying the testicles. This can cause an elevation of testicular temperature, which can impact sperm production. It is most common in one testicle, but can also influence both. If it influences both testicles, it is more likely to cause infertility.

Additionally, testicular varicocele can lead to a condition called oligoasthenoteratozoospermia, which is characterized by low-quality spermatozoa in terms of both quantity and quality, including motility and morphology.

Adequate treatment can lead to notable improvement in cases of oligoasthenoteratozoospermia associated with testicular varicocele. Surgery is generally considered the most effective treatment, particularly in severe instances.

Hypogonadism and oligospermy: links in reproductive health

Male hypogonadism is a condition characterized by insufficient production of sex hormones, including testosterone, by the testicles. This condition has a direct impact on sperm production and can result in infertility.

Male hypogonadism can be classified into two main types:

  • Primary hypogonadism: the testes do not function properly due to a problem in the testes themselves. The most common genetic disorder of this type is Klinefelter’s syndrome, which can result in low testosterone levels, reduced muscle mass, poor facial and body hair, and reduced sperm production.
  • Secondary hypogonadism occurs when there is a problem in the hypothalamus or pituitary glands, which are responsible for producing the hormones that stimulate sperm production in the testes.

Treatment of this condition depends on the type of hypogonadism. In some cases, hormonal treatment can help restore testicular function and increase sperm production, leading to improved fertility projection.

Hydrocele

Testicular hydrocele is a condition that causes fluid to accumulate around one or both testicles. It can be congenital or acquired, and is more common in men over 40 years of age.

Hydrocele is generally not a direct cause of infertility, although it may be associated with infertility in around 10% of cases. In these instances, it can lead to a partial obstruction of the vas deferens, potentially resulting in a decreased sperm count in the semen.

Oligoasthenoteratozoospermia

Oligoteratozoospermia refers to a condition where the concentration of spermatozoa in the semen is low, and the shape of the spermatozoa is abnormal. This term combines two observations from a spermogram: “oligo,” indicating a low sperm concentration (less than 15 million per milliliter), and “terato,” representing a low percentage of sperm with normal morphology (less than 4%). The presence of abnormal sperm morphology can hinder fertilization and potentially affect the development of embryos.

Men with severe oligoteratozoospermia who want to have children will need to undergo in vitro fertilization (IVF) treatment with intracytoplasmic sperm injection (ICSI). In this treatment, sperm with good shape are selected under the microscope and injected directly into the egg, thus increasing the chances of a healthy embryo.
